Rubber fuel hose is among the cheapest parts on a 1999 Yamaha PW50 and one of the few that can end a ride outright. It hardens, cracks, and weeps fuel where you cannot see it, eventually either starving the engine or putting gasoline somewhere it should never be. Swapping it needs no specialty tools and no shop time.
How a Failing Line Announces Itself
A fuel line rarely fails without hinting first. Run through this list before loading the PW50 up, particularly if the bike has been sitting.
- Fuel staining at either fitting. Seepage shows up at the barbs before anywhere else.
- Persistent gasoline smell. If you smell fuel with the bike cold and untouched, something is leaking.
- Cracks that appear when you flex the hose. Dry rot hides at rest and reveals itself the moment rubber bends.
- Swelling or a soft, mushy section. The opposite of hardening and just as bad — usually chemical attack.
- Surging or dying under load. Restricted flow mimics fuel starvation and gets misdiagnosed as a jetting problem.
The Carbureted Setup on This PW50
Fuel delivery on the 1999 Yamaha PW50 is carbureted, so the plumbing is about as simple as it gets on a two-stroke dirt bike — tank, petcock, hose, carburetor. That petcock is the most useful thing about this job. Turn it off and the fuel stops, which means no siphoning and no fighting gravity while you work.
Why This Part Wears Out at All
Two things degrade a fuel line: time, and what sits inside it. Rubber loses flexibility as it ages, and a hose that spent eight years on a 1999 Yamaha PW50 has been hardening the whole time, ridden or parked. Hardened rubber cannot absorb vibration, so it cracks where it stretches over a fitting. Ethanol-blended gasoline is the other half — fuel sitting unused for months attracts moisture and breaks down, which is rough on hose material and leaves varnish behind. Add a dry climate baking out what flexibility remains, and a line that looked fine last season can be brittle by spring.
What to Have on the Bench
The parts list is short and the tool list shorter. Lay it out before breaking the first connection.
- Replacement fuel line in the correct inside diameter and length for your 1999 Yamaha PW50. Match the original rather than guessing — oversized line will not seal on the barb.
- New clamps. Spring clamps lose tension with age, and a small clamp kit costs very little.
- Nitrile or rubber gloves. Gasoline absorbs through skin.
- A fuel-safe drain container and a funnel if you plan to reuse the fuel.
- Pliers and a small flat screwdriver for spring and screw clamps respectively.
- Shop rags and eye protection.
One genuine safety note: gasoline vapor is heavier than air and travels along the floor toward anything that can ignite it. Work outdoors or with the door open, shut off any heater with a pilot light, keep the fuel container capped, and let a hot engine cool first.
Getting the Old Line Out of the Way
Close the petcock. Everything downstream of that valve is the only fuel you need to deal with, which on a 1999 Yamaha PW50 amounts to a few ounces in the line and float bowl.
Get that remaining fuel into a container rather than onto the floor. The float bowl drain screw is purpose-built for this — slip a hose over the nipple, aim it into your catch can, and crack the screw open. If you would rather drain the whole tank, do it now with the hose routed into the container.
Then release both clamps and work the hose off the fittings. Pliers handle spring clamps; a flat screwdriver handles screw clamps. Slide each clamp well back so it cannot fight you. To separate a stubborn hose from a barb, rotate it a quarter turn to shear the bond before pulling. If the rubber has gone hard enough that it will not release, split it with a knife along its length — the hose is being replaced anyway, and the fittings are what matter.
Fitting the New Line
Measure the replacement against the old line before cutting. Matching the original length keeps routing correct on the PW50, and a square cut gives the clamp a clean surface to seal against. Trim with a fresh blade rather than dull side cutters.
Slide the hose fully onto the tank-side fitting, past the barb and up against the shoulder. If the rubber resists, soften it in hot water; do not reach for lubricant. Grease or oil on a fuel fitting shows up later as a slow weep and can carry contamination into the carburetor.
Attach the carburetor end and check the shape of the run. The hose should follow the original path with no contact against cylinder or exhaust and no kink where it curves. Install fresh clamps over the fitting area rather than out on bare hose, and tighten only until the rubber is compressed — a screw clamp cranked down hard will eventually cut through.
Verifying the Repair
Turn the petcock back on and give it time. Several minutes of sitting over clean cardboard will reveal a gravity leak that a quick glance would not. Inspect both connection points closely, by touch as well as by eye, since a slow weep often shows up as nothing more than dampness at the clamp.
Start it up next. Heat and vibration change the picture, so run the engine to temperature and inspect the joints again at idle. A leak appearing only when running usually means the hose is not seated deeply enough — take it apart and reseat rather than adding clamp tension, which only damages rubber.
Once it passes both tests, finish the housekeeping. Handle the drained fuel responsibly and think twice about reusing it if it has gone stale. Recheck the fittings after the first ride, since a new hose settles onto the barbs.
